Output 7654f37f16048efc656623e920c66bd24e3a0dab9b9a069a53ed90bfbb44aacb:0

value
3571300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685c0f68cfca77f5f217bb1ba462f44738c583a3 OP_EQUAL
address
3BCpUwxu8H2nx8w9aDhsvNsb5mFDLHpZrc
transaction
7654f37f16048efc656623e920c66bd24e3a0dab9b9a069a53ed90bfbb44aacb
confirmations
188237
spent
true